Graves Avenue Collision Kills 48-Year-Old Woman
Los Angeles, CA (December 9, 2022) – On Tuesday, Jiu Qiu, a 48-year-old woman from Rosemead, lost her life in a traffic crash on Falling Leaf Avenue.
It was about 6:37 p.m. when the accident took place in the area of Graves Avenue, west of San Gabriel Boulevard.
CHP Officer Elizabeth Kravig confirmed Jiu Qiu died at the crash scene.
In the meantime, the authorities are investigating the Graves Avenue collision.

Moreover, know that each state has its own laws covering who can file the claim on behalf of the deceased.
Furthermore, these people are related to or financially dependent on the deceased. Additionally, the law usually allows the following people to file a wrongful death case:
- Surviving spouses
- Domestic partners (registered domestic partnership)
- Children of the deceased
- Financial dependents, parents, and minors under the care of the deceased
- Personal representatives
